Aumsville, OR vs Saunders Lake, OR
Aumsville, OR and Saunders Lake, OR have a very similar cost of living, with only a 3.4% difference in their overall index. Aumsville scores 114 while Saunders Lake scores 111 on the cost of living index, where 100 represents the national average. The day-to-day expenses for residents in both cities are comparable, though differences emerge when looking at specific categories.
On the housing front, median rent in Aumsville is $1,760/month compared to $1,367/month in Saunders Lake — a 29%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Saunders Lake has cheaper rent, Aumsville actually has lower median home values ($307,400 vs $396,500).
Median household income in Aumsville is $89,651 compared to $87,750 in Saunders Lake (+2.2%). The higher salaries in Aumsville partially offset the cost difference, but don't fully close the gap. Looking at affordability, residents of Aumsville spend roughly 23.6% of their income on rent, more than the 18.7% in Saunders Lake.
Climate-wise, both cities share similar average temperatures (54.1°F vs 53°F). Saunders Lake receives more rainfall at 59.1" per year compared to 40.1" in Aumsville.
